Faculty of Liberal Arts Department of Language and Culture

Recruitment stopped in April 2023

For all students enrolled in faculties and departments that will cease accepting new students, we will ensure that they maintain their affiliation with their chosen department and the educational environment there until graduation. We, the faculty and staff, will also fulfill our responsibility to provide support for their student life, career paths, and job placement.

Education in this department

Exploring better communication while learning about linguistic and cultural diversity.

Based on intensive study of English plus one foreign language (German, French, Chinese, or Korean), students will broadly and intensively study specialized fields related to language and culture (see below). The goal is to learn about the diversity of languages and cultures and to find the possibility of better communication (dialogue) by overcoming these differences. The communication skills cultivated here will serve as a foundation for success in all fields of society, including education, finance, tourism/aviation, and media.

Specialized fields

The structure of language

There are many mysteries hidden in the words we use casually. Notice them, observe them, and think about why.

Expression and Culture

By analyzing and studying examples of outstanding expression in film, theater, photography, etc., and by actually creating them themselves, students will explore the breadth and possibilities of various media expressions.

Language acquisition and education

Why is it so difficult to learn a foreign language when you can speak Japanese without even realizing it? You will experience the joy and difficulty of learning and teaching a language and deepen your understanding.

Languages and cultures of various regions around the world

Students aim to acquire English, German, French, Chinese, and Korean languages, while also gaining an understanding of the Anglo-American, European, and East Asian cultures in which these languages are used.

Language and Communication

Other people are different from us. But how is it that we can understand the minds of others? We will explore this question by analyzing the nature of communication.

Cultural Structure

By taking up a wide range of topics, from art and philosophy to family, food, clothing, shelter, love, and fortune-telling, students will deepen their understanding of diverse cultures and deepen their exploration of how culture works.
